Enjoyable, if rather hot, afternoon at the
Greenwich Fair, part of the
Greenwich & Dockland International Festival.

| The Iron Man |
OK - some of the acts were somewhat oversold in the brochure, but some of the main performances were very good. The highlight for me was the
Graeae production of Ted Hughes'
The Iron Man in St Alfege Park. Perhaps an overly - and over-egged staging, the Iron Man himself was superb. It is a shame that the space-bat-dragon-thing was not so well realised. It was pretty easy to guess who was going to win! Anyway, thoroughly enjoyable.

| Guixot de 8's (non-functional) version of Tinguely |
Also saw
Candoco Dance Company's aerobatic take on the Icarus legend
"Heartland" on a domed rig by the Old Royal Naval College, and some baroque juggling -
"Smashed" - by
Gandini. Managed to avoid Emergency Exit Arts' giant meerkats, which from the publicity literature looked frankly too creepy/scary, but enjoyed Guixot de 8's fun interactive versions of modern sculpture.
